Vologda vs Yokohama Climate & Distance Between

Japan flag
  • The distance between Vologda, Russia and Yokohama, Japan is approximately 7,187 km or 4,466 mi.
  • To reach Vologda in this distance one would set out from Yokohama bearing 326.2°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Vologda bearing 242.7° or WSW .
  • Vologda has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Yokohama has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Vologda is in or near the boreal moist forest biome whereas Yokohama is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 12.6 °C (22.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.5 °C (15.3°F) more in Vologda.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 995.3 mm (39.2 in) less which is equivalent to 995.3 l/m² (24.43 US gal/ft²) or 9,953,000 l/ha (1,064,042 US gal/ac) less. About 3/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 23.9° lower in Vologda than in Yokohama.
  • Relative humidity levels are 10.8%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 10.1°C (18.3°F) lower.
